JCEC met and evaluated candidates for two vacancies during 2019-2020:
1. Vacancy on the Virginia Court of Appeals (Judge Rossie Alston)
The Virginia State Bar was asked by Senator John Edwards of the Judiciary Committee of the Senate of Virginia to evaluate candidates for the vacancy on the Court of Appeals of Virginia due to the appointment of Judge Rossie Alston to the federal bench. Interviews of candidates took place on Wednesday, February 19, 2020.
After conducting its usual exhaustive background investigation and interviewing the candidates, the committee made the following determinations on the candidates who were found to be qualified and highly qualified. This information was conveyed to Senator Edwards at the conclusion of the process, along with individual reports on each candidate. As of June 30, 2020, the General Assembly had not selected a candidate to replace Judge Alston.

The JCEC policy, amended in 2016, Paragraph II.G. provides:
If a candidate has previously been evaluated by the Committee for the same position and received a rating of “Qualified” or “Highly Qualified,” there shall be a rebuttable presumption that the candidate merits at least the same rating. In order for the presumption to be rebutted, the Committee must be presented with information reflecting on the candidate’s qualifications that warrants a vote to a lower rating.
- Vacancy on the federal court in the Western District of Virginia (Judge Glen Conrad)
Senators Tim Kaine and John Warner asked the committee in 2020 to evaluate an additional candidate for the Western District of Virginia vacancy occasioned by Judge Conrad taking senior status. The six JCEC members who were available to conduct a background investigation, interview and evaluate Mr. Cullen rated him Highly Qualified 6-0 and Qualified 6-0.
A written report was provided to the Senators regarding Mr. Cullen.
